Comment 2 Rich Mattes 2013-04-03 17:42:37 UTC
FTBFS was due to removal of deprecated of kernel interfaces for v4l2 and a broken graphviz pkgconfig file.  New typedefs were subbed in for kernel interface, and broken pkgconfig was worked around.
